Web16 de ago. de 2024 · To correctly trace underfloor heating, the user should turn on the system and hold the thermal camera steadily pointing at the floor once it has fully warmed up. Temperature directly above pipes tends to be at roughly 26˚C compared to an average floor temperature of 18˚C. WebBut it's typically more expensive to run than water-based systems, due to the high cost of electricity. Water underfloor heating is cheaper to run than electric systems, but it's more expensive to install and it's advisable to get professionals to do it. Water systems are more efficient than electric systems, especially in larger areas. WebProduct information. Web1 de set. de 2024 · Backing boards are typically between 12mm to 25mm thick. They provide a good, flat sub-base for a tile floor finish but the insulation value is as would be expected from a material that is 12mm to 25mm thick. There is no magic with insulation.

WebSpread the adhesive on the back of an underfloor heating mat and ensure a decent covering. The adhesive itself will be good for about 10 – 20 lifts so if you make a mistake you can simply lift the mat and relay.
